Справочник функций

Ваш аккаунт

Войти через: 
Забыли пароль?
Регистрация
Информацию о новых материалах можно получать и без регистрации:

Почтовая рассылка

Подписчиков: -1
Последний выпуск: 19.06.2015

методом простой итерации. в чем ошибка подскажите пожалуйста

74K
09 ноября 2011 года
Demon22
3 / / 23.10.2011
var a,x,y:Real;
i:Integer;
begin
x:=StrToFloat(Edit1.Text);
i:=0;
if y(x)=0 then Memo1.Lines.Add(FloatToStr(x))
else while not(y(x)=0) do
begin
x:=2*x-3*ln(x)-3;
x:=a;
inc(i);
if i:=StrToInt(Edit2.Text) then Break
end;
Memo2.Line.Add(IntToStr(i)+''+FloatToStr(x);
end;
63K
09 декабря 2011 года
Illiren
19 / / 13.03.2011
Это pascal? У тебя в цикле while [COLOR="blue"]x[/COLOR] все время равен [COLOR="blue"]a[/COLOR].
 
Код:
Memo2.Line.Add(IntToStr(i)+''+FloatToStr(x);
закрывающую скобку забыл.
 
Код:
if i:=StrToInt(Edit2.Text) then
вместо [COLOR="blue"]=[/COLOR] ты написал [COLOR="blue"]:=[/COLOR]
Реклама на сайте | Обмен ссылками | Ссылки | Экспорт (RSS) | Контакты
Добавить статью | Добавить исходник | Добавить хостинг-провайдера | Добавить сайт в каталог